Fees and Financial Aid
The Noida Institute of Engineering and Technology (NIET) in Greater Noida offers a B.Tech program with transparent fees and scholarship opportunities to support students. The total fee for the four-year program is ?6,44,400. In the first year, the fee is ?1,79,100, which includes ?1,18,400 for tuition, ?7,500 for external exams, ?4,000 for internal exams, and ?16,000 for technical fees. From the second year onwards, the yearly fee is ?1,55,100. The fee structure remains consistent throughout the course and applies equally to all categories (General, SC, ST, OBC). NIET offers several scholarships, such as a ?10,000 fee waiver for female students scoring above 60% in 10th, 12th, and graduation. The UP Government Scholarship supports economically weaker students, and top-ranking students in exams like JEE Main can secure fee waivers. Hostel fees range from ?90,000 to ?1,20,000 annually. NIET provides affordable education with solid support for deserving students.

Hostel Facilities
Hostel facility is quite good, their 1st year students hostel is situated at a very different place from the 2nd & 3rd year, so there in no chance of ragging like scenes there, the food is good, maximum facilities are provided with fitness and sports

Night Life
Nightlife is quite good, basically if you are a Hosteller you can't go out after 8pm , if there is a emergency you can go at any time, or you can get permission for the late entry in college if you are planning to go somewhere
